每次备份都是用当前数据跟上一次的数据进行比较,找出差异,然后备份 恢复数据: 全量备份+增量1+增量2+增量3..。 1. 2. 3. 4. 5. 3、为何要备份 运维三大职责 - 应用程序7*24*365不间断运行=>围绕三层,做好监控 - 备份=>数据丢失情况下,保证数据可以恢复回来 - 优化性能:提升用户访问速度 备份什么===...
rsync 全名 Remote Sync,是类 UNIX 系统下的数据镜像备份工具。可以方便的实现本地,远程备份,rsync 提供了丰富的选项来控制其行为。rsync 优于其他工具的重要一点就是支持增量备份。 rsync - a fast, versatile, remote (and local) file-copying tool rsync 是一个功能非常强大的工具,其命令也有很多功能选项,它...
--> snapshot时间戳文件是每次增量备份完成时候更新的,如果在两次备份间隔间,由于io问题,上次备份没完成,第二次增量备份就开始的话, 就有可能出现,第二次增量备份并不是一个备份间隔有修改过的文件,而是两次;如果IO问题一直存在,就会一直累积备份,最后系统超负载,性能变得极差 --> 上次备份失败(意外终止) 这样的...
提示:内网不需要加密,加密性能能有损失 跨机房,使用vpn(pptp, openvpn, ipsec) rsync 优点: 增量备份,支持socket(deamon),集中备份(支持推拉,以客户端为参照物) 可以利用ssh, vpn服务等加密传输远程数据 缺点: 大量小文件同步时候,对比时间长,有时候rsync进程会停止 同步大文件,比如10G会出现中断问题,未同步完成...
(1)主服务器向备份服务器备份 # rsync -vzrtopg --delete --progress backup@192.168.10.3::www /back (2)备份服务器的恢复(主服务器read only = no) # rsync -vzrtopg --delete --progress /back backup@192.168.10.3::www (3)增量备份(主要用这个) ...
这个玩客云是Cortex A5的芯片,性能比较差,但同时功耗也低,可以全天侯开机,所以就可以继续拿它做文章,再找一个自动同步、备份文件的解决方案就可以了。 一查还真有,就是今天要介绍的rsync。 rsync 是一个常用的 Linux 应用程序,用于文件同步。 它可以在本地计算机与远程计算机之间,或者两个本地目录之间同步文件(但...
Rsync (remote rsync) 是可以实现增量备份的远程(和本地)文件复制工具,目的是实现本地主机和远程主机上的文件同步(包括本地推到远程,远程拉到本地两种同步方式),也可以实现本地不同路径下(不同目录、分区之间)文件的同步,但不能实现远程路径1到远程路径2之间的同步(scp可以实现)。配合计划任务,rsync能实现定时或...
增加物理内存:如果条件允许,增加服务器的物理内存是一种直接而有效的方法,更多的内存允许系统缓存更多的数据,在备份大量文件时可以显著提升性能。 使用更快的硬盘:使用固态硬盘(SSD)而不是传统的机械硬盘可以大幅提升数据的读写速度,减少I/O等待时间,间接减少内存使用。
1.Rsync:增量传输的强大工具 Rsync 是一款支持文件同步的工具,广泛应用于备份和传输大文件。它最强大的功能是支持增量传输,只传输源和目标之间的差异部分,从而节省带宽和时间。此外,Rsync 支持本地和远程同步,并且能够保留文件的元数据信息如权限、时间戳等,适合复杂的传输需求。
管理大规模数据的rsync,例如一个包含数万个子目录和TB级文件的仓库,可能会遇到时间消耗和性能瓶颈。这时,使用rsync的高级选项至关重要。例如,通过添加`-c`选项,可以启用校验和而非时间戳来检测变更,虽然耗时,但确保了数据的准确性。处理大量数据时,可能会遇到“发送增量文件列表”提示的问题。通过...